029 | [Situation] Running in Southerly direction passing near the East Side of Drumneil & runs under Glentriplock Bridge near the west side of Blairshinnoch A considerable stream or burn rising from the Flow of Airiewhillart and Chilcarroch Loch and running in, a southerly direction to its influx with Luce Bay: at Port William Quay This Burn takes its name from the adjoining farms through which it runs all with the exception of Drumniel & GlentriplicK.- |

029 | A small farm of land with office houses including Thrashing machine & a small dwelling house which is occupied by the caretaker. This farm along with Drummit is occupied by Peter Cluckie, the property of Sir William Maxwell of Monreith. About one mile NNE of Kirk of Mochrum. |

Ordnance Survey - Wigtown county, OS Name Books - Wigtown county - Volume 73 - Parishes of Mochrum and Kirkinner, OS1/35/73
This volume contains information on place names found in the Wigtownshire parishes of Mochrum and Kirkinner.
